Step-by-step preparation

Cooking timeCooking time: 1 hr 50 mins
  1. STEP 1

    STEP 1

    How to bake potatoes in the oven? Prepare the ingredients according to the list. It is preferable to choose potato tubers of the same size. You can replace fresh rosemary with dry herbs. Instead of olive oil, you can use any vegetable oil of your choice. You can also use special potato seasoning mixtures. Replace ground black pepper with paprika.

  2. STEP 2

    STEP 2

    Wash the potatoes, peel and rinse again in running water. If the potatoes are large, cut them in half, leaving small tubers whole.

  3. STEP 3

    STEP 3

    Place the peeled potatoes in a saucepan, fill them with water so that it covers them completely. Add a pinch of salt and put on fire. Bring the water to a boil and cook over medium heat for about 10 minutes. We don't need to boil the potatoes until tender, keep that in mind.

  4. STEP 4

    STEP 4

    Separate the head of garlic into cloves.

  5. STEP 5

    STEP 5

    Remove the leaves from the rosemary sprigs. In a bowl, combine rosemary, unpeeled garlic and 2 tbsp. l. olive oil.

  6. STEP 6

    STEP 6

    Place the boiled potatoes in a colander and leave for 5 minutes to allow the water to drain and the tubers to dry slightly.

  7. STEP 7

    STEP 7

    Place the potatoes in a baking dish greased with olive oil, add salt and pepper.

  8. STEP 8

    STEP 8

    Place the pan with potatoes in an oven preheated to 190°C for about 20-30 minutes. Determine the exact baking time and temperature based on your oven. Remove the partially baked potatoes from the oven and lightly press the tubers with a potato masher.

  9. STEP 9

    STEP 9

    Spread rosemary and garlic soaked in olive oil over the surface of the potatoes. Return the pan to the oven for another 25-40 minutes and bake the potatoes until golden brown.

I asked my husband to buy some potatoes, and he brought some kind of “peas”) And if they were young, I would bake them in their skins, but the potatoes turned out to be not very young. I started looking for a recipe to put it in. And I found the right one! But I didn’t want to peel it, so I washed the potatoes and boiled them until half cooked. Then I cleaned it, so the skin is easier to remove. I didn't have any fresh rosemary or garlic. So I did it a little differently. Directly in the form, I poured oil over the potatoes, sprinkled with garlic powder, smoked paprika, added a pinch of potato seasoning and dried rosemary. I love the combination of potatoes and rosemary! I mixed it all and baked it, putting a few garlic cloves on top so that they transferred their spicy aroma to the potatoes. After 30 minutes, I crushed the tubers with a masher, removed the arrows and baked for another 20 minutes. The baked potatoes in the oven turned out great! Beautiful, golden, very tasty with a spicy aftertaste. The aroma of garlic and rosemary is amazing. I always think that rosemary smells like pine and citrus, so I really like this fragrant bouquet. And it complements baked potatoes perfectly.
